My Box Set Up Updates
Hello All,
Thought id post some shots of my box set up. Just recently built a new box and got some shots. I have 2 boxes runnin at the moment. Each is 2-30 gallon rubber maids one flipped ontop of the other. One with Og Bubblegum the other Sour Slut. (Thnx to Sunsimulator) Both boxes have 4-42 watt cfls. With 1 pc fan each for cooling. Temps are steady at 77f-80f. Plants are in FFOF soil. Fed Fox Farm grow Big in veg and now in bloom getting pbp bloom. This time around I added some domlite lime at 1.5 TBSP per gallon of soil. What a diff it made in growth. I dont think ive ever had plants this green and healthy. Plant pics are from newly rooted to end of week 1 bloom. This is the info that came with the bg cuts

Red_Greenery Thnx for stoppin in you do some real nice work yourself. I used a screen when i first started growing. Allways seemed to be in the way. Now i use rubber coated paperclips. They work well to bend and hold things back away from the lights. If theres a branch thats not where it needs to be I string together a few clips and pull it where it needs to be. From the looks of these plants im gonna need to pick up more clips.
